What is the purpose of tags in a telecommunications system?

Explanation:
Tags in a telecommunications system serve a crucial role in indicating the mounting surface, providing important information for installation and maintenance. They help technicians understand where equipment or pathways should be mounted, which is essential for maintaining organization and ensuring that systems are easily accessible. Proper tagging allows for quick identification of components, facilitating troubleshooting and system upgrades. The process of tagging contributes to the overall efficiency of managing telecommunications infrastructure. By ensuring that mounting surfaces are clearly identified, tags help reduce miscommunication and errors during installations or when modifications are needed. This is especially important in environments where numerous cables and devices are present, as it minimizes confusion and enhances the speed of service. While the other options discuss various aspects of telecommunications systems—such as identifying data centers, establishing electrical connections, or enhancing security—none are the primary function of tags in this context. Tags are fundamentally about organization and clarity regarding installation locations, aligning with the aim of creating an efficient and manageable system.
